Arant Haw

Sedbergh, United Kingdom • 22 Mar 2026

Event Overview

The Arant Haw fell race takes place on Sunday, 22 March 2026. It is categorized as an AS race. The event includes a senior race and separate junior races for different age categories.

Course Details

The race covers a distance of 7.5 km / 4.7 miles with a total climb of 400 m / 1312 ft. The senior race starts at 12:15, while all juniors start together at 11:15 from a location a 10-minute walk from the main venue. Participants must follow specific equipment requirements.

Venue and Logistics

The event uses the Peoples Hall in Sedbergh, LA10 5DQ as its venue. There is no parking available at the Peoples Hall. Pre-entry is required for the race; entry on the day is not permitted. Refreshments will be available, and cash is requested for purchases.

Requirements and Additional Information

Senior runners are required to carry a waterproof coat and trousers, a hat, gloves, and a whistle. The event has a UK Athletics permit and insurance from the FRA. The senior race is the final event in a Winter League, with a prize-giving ceremony afterwards. No early starts are allowed, and a cut-off time will be enforced.
